Transaction 77a04506decf7c9b84ad3ac092725214886291c3c541f5c39aea336626b90605

2 Input
2 Outputs
  • 77a04506decf7c9b84ad3ac092725214886291c3c541f5c39aea336626b90605:0
  • value  1603922
    address  34wsid11pzYbNApqZ9EY2SzbGLBqEm2dft
  • 77a04506decf7c9b84ad3ac092725214886291c3c541f5c39aea336626b90605:1
  • value  588740
    address  35g2LUuxgBXC15q9jGqGqSG4GMXxmsxbJn